GRILLED STUFFED TOMATOES



Grilled Stuffed Tomatoes image

Provided by Patrick and Gina Neely : Food Network

Categories     appetizer

Time 20m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

6 large tomatoes
2 tablespoons chopped green onions
2 tablespoons chopped basil leaves
6 ounces goat cheese
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 cups cooked orzo
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1/4 cup grated Parmesan

Steps:

  • Preheat the grill to medium heat.
  • Cut the tomatoes and core them, removing all the seeds and juice.
  • In a medium bowl add the onions, basil, and goat cheese. Mix and season with salt and freshly ground black pepper. Add cooked orzo and combine. Stuff the tomatoes with the mixture. Drizzle olive oil over the tomatoes. Top the tomatoes with the Parmesan.
  • Place the tomatoes directly on the grill with the cover closed and cook for 10 minutes. The juices will begin to run. Remove from grill and place on platter.

BLUE CHEESE CRUSTED TOMATOES



Blue Cheese Crusted Tomatoes image

Provided by Judith Fertig

Categories     Tomato     Side     Fourth of July     Vegetarian     Quick & Easy     Low Cal     Backyard BBQ     Blue Cheese     Summer     Grill     Grill/Barbecue     Bon Appétit     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Makes 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 4

1/2 cup fine dry breadcrumbs
1 tablespoon olive oil
12 medium tomatoes
3/4 cup crumbled blue cheese (about 3 ounces)

Steps:

  • Prepare barbecue (high heat), leaving opposite side unlit if gas grill or without coals if charcoal grill. Mix breadcrumbs and olive oil in small bowl, mashing to coat. Cut top 1/4 from each tomato. Sprinkle tomatoes with salt and pepper. Top each with 1 tablespoon blue cheese. Sprinkle with breadcrumb mixture.
  • Arrange tomatoes (topping side up) on unlit side of grill. Cover grill and cook tomatoes until slightly soft and cheese melts, about 13 minutes. Serve immediately.

GRILLED TOMATOES STUFFED WITH BACON, BASIL, & BLUE CHEESE



Grilled Tomatoes Stuffed With Bacon, Basil, & Blue Cheese image

Make and share this Grilled Tomatoes Stuffed With Bacon, Basil, & Blue Cheese recipe from Food.com.

Provided by gailanng

Categories     Vegetable

Time 35m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for oiling the grill grate
5 slices bacon, diced
2/3 cup diced red onion
1 large garlic clove, diced
3/4 cup breadcrumbs
1/4 cup coarsely chopped fresh basil leaf
1/2 cup loosely packed coarsely crumbled blue cheese
6 large ripe tomatoes (6 - 7 ounces each)
1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
salt & fre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Lightly oil the grill grate. Preheat a gas grill to medium or prepare a medium-hot fire in a charcoal grill.
  • Cook the bacon in a large skillet over medium heat until lightly browned and most of the fat is rendered, 5 to 8 minutes, stirring often and adjusting the heat as necessary. Using a slotted spoon, transfer the bacon to a paper towel-lined plate to drain, reserving 1 1/2 tablespoons of bacon fat in the skillet.
  • Add the red onion to the skillet and cook over medium heat until it begins to soften, 2 - 3 minutes, stirring often. Add the garlic and cook until fragrant and the onion is softened, about 1 minute. Add the bread crumbs and basil and stir until well combined. Transfer the onion mixture to a medium-size bowl. Add the blue cheese and the drained bacon and set aside.
  • Cut about a 1/2-inch-thick slice off the stem end of each tomato. Using a paring knife, remove the cores of the tomatoes by cutting a cone-shaped piece about 2 inches deep and 1 1/2 inches wide in each. Cut a very thin sliver off the bottom of each tomato to help stabilize it as it grills.
  • Whisk together the olive oil and wine vinegar and drizzle about 1 teaspoon of the dressing over each tomato. Sprinkle the tops of the tomatoes lightly with salt and pepper to taste. Divide the bacon and blue cheese mixture evenly among the tomatoes, filling the cores and patting the mixture firmly in place to cover the top of each tomato.
  • Place the tomatoes on the oiled grill grate, cover the grill, and grill the tomatoes until they have softened and the stuffing is warmed through, 10 to 15 minutes. If you are using a charcoal grill, check the tomatoes after about 5 minutes and if the fire is too hot, causing the tomatoes to burn or cook too quickly, move them to the edge of the grill to continue cooking. If you need the center of the grill for cooking other foods, such as chicken or steak, the tomatoes can be cooked on the outer edge of the grill or on the grill's top shelf over the main cooking grate; the cooking time will be longer.
  • Alternative Oven Method: Bake the tomatoes in a shallow oiled baking dish in an oven preheated to 400°F After baking the tomatoes for about 12 minutes, place them under the broiler for about 1 minute to lightly brown the stuffing.

BLUE CHEESE STUFFED TOMATOES



Blue Cheese Stuffed Tomatoes image

Provided by Katie Lee Biegel

Categories     appetizer

Time 25m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 pint grape tomatoes
Kosher salt and freshly cracked black pepper
2 ounces cream cheese, at room temperature
1/2 cup blue cheese
2 tablespoons finely chopped fresh chives
4 slices crispy cooked bacon, finely chopped
1 tablespoon hot honey (or 1 tablespoon honey mixed with a dash of hot sauce)

Steps:

  • Slice the top third (stem side) off each tomato. Cut a small slice off each bottom so that the tomatoes are flat and able to stand up. Using a melon baller or small spoon, remove the inside of each tomato to hollow out the center. Place the tomatoes on a plate or platter. Sprinkle the tomatoes with 1/4 teaspoon salt.
  • Mash the cream cheese in a bowl with a rubber spatula until it is soft and malleable. Gently fold in the blue cheese, being careful not to overmix and break the blue clumps. Season with pepper. Use two small spoons to fill the tomatoes with the blue cheese mixture. (How much will depend on the size of the tomato; small tomatoes should get about 1 teaspoon of the mixture. You can also transfer the mixture to a pastry bag or resealable plastic bag with the corner cut off and pipe the cheese mixture into each tomato.)
  • Toss the chives and bacon together in a small bowl. Top each tomato with the mixture. Drizzle hot honey over the entire plate. Serve.

GRILLED MUSHROOMS STUFFED WITH BASIL AND BLUE CHEESE BUTTER



Grilled Mushrooms Stuffed with Basil and Blue Cheese Butter image

This is simply mushrooms stuffed with the same blue cheese butter recipe I usually use to top grilled steak or burgers!

Provided by BudsGurls

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Vegetable     Mushrooms     Stuffed Mushroom Recipes

Time 20m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 (6 ounce) package button mushrooms, stemmed
1 tablespoon olive oil, or as needed
⅓ cup crumbled blue cheese
2 tablespoons butter
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 tablespoon chopped fresh basil
salt and 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Coat tops of mushrooms with olive oil. Place mushrooms top-down in a grill-safe dish.
  • Mix blue cheese, butter, garlic, basil, salt, and pepper thoroughly in a bowl. Scoop evenly into the mushroom caps.
  • Preheat an outdoor grill for medium-high heat and lightly oil the grate. Cook mushrooms until tender and heated through, about 5 minutes.

BLUE CHEESE STUFFED TOMATOES



Blue Cheese Stuffed Tomatoes image

Make and share this Blue Cheese Stuffed Tomatoes recipe from Food.com.

Provided by SimplyME

Categories     Vegetable

Time 1h15m

Yield 20-30 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 pint cherry tomatoes
2 (3 ounce) packages cream cheese, softened
1/2 cup crumbled blue cheese
2 tablespoons sour cream
2 tablespoons finely chopped celery
1 tablespoon finely chopped onion
3/4 cup finely chopped walnuts or 3/4 cup pecans

Steps:

  • Cut off tomato tops to make caps.
  • Scoop out pulp from caps and bottoms.
  • Beat cream cheese, blue cheese and sour cream in bowl until well blended.
  • Add celery onion and nuts; mix well.
  • Spoon or pipe into tomato shells, mounding slightly.
  • Replace tomato caps; secure with toothpicks.
  • Chill in refrigertor.
  • Garnish with parsley, if desired.

GRILLED TOMATOES



Grilled Tomatoes image

Perfect, easy, and yummy!

Provided by Lynne2478

Categories     Side Dish     Vegetables     Tomatoes

Time 25m

Yield 16

Number Of Ingredients 4

8 tomatoes, halved lengthwise
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 cloves garlic, minced, or to taste
1 teaspoon salt and 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Preheat an outdoor grill for medium-high heat, and lightly oil the grate.
  • Drizzle the olive oil over the cut sides of the tomatoes, and sprinkle with garlic, salt, and black pepper.
  • Place tomatoes, cut sides up, onto the preheated grill, and grill until the tomatoes start to sizzle and show blackened grill marks, about 4 minutes. Flip the tomatoes over and grill until the garlic turns golden brown, about 3 more minutes.
